Reminder: There will be SLS only (folk that are interested in doing SLS) sessions at KH on sunday :)
OK...all those on the Who's In List, he is your chance to have a run out at Knockhill at the HOT HATCH DAY on the 21st of April. We are going to reseve one session exclusively for SLS Who's In drivers, MAX 25 cars. The cost is £55, must be pre booked and as a special additional benefit, the Who's In driver plus a mechanic mate will get in free and save £20 at the gate on the day admission. It will be an idea opportunity to shake down your car and circulate with fellow SLS drivers to get to know each other on track and follow the SLS proceedures on track (Lights on on a hot lap / over taking on the left / give due consideration to others who are on a hot lap / wear the correct MSA safety gear). It is a clockwise Hot Hatch. Please phone 01383 723337 to pre book. It will be great to start showcasing the type and spread of cars entered and hopefully attract more to the event on the 25th / 26th May.
also Rolling road/weigh days at Extreme and Wallace Performance on Sat morning :)
